Ravelry 101

Ravelry is a useful way for you to keep track of your knitting projects—past, present, and future. You don’t need to remember all the details of a given project because you can store them on your project pages. You can start a Favorites page to gather ideas for future projects, and you can add your pattern purchases to your Ravelry Library so they’ll never get lost.

Skills Taught
How to:
  • Join Ravelry
  • Find patterns using Advanced Search techniques, specifying construction techniques, yarn, garment style elments, and more
  • Look up a pattern you plan to make and check out the colors and yarns others have used  
  • Find free patterns
  • Check out What’s Hot among currently purchased patterns
  • See which projects are the most popular 
  • Find the best uses for those impulse yarn purchases nesting in your stash
  • Join a KAL (Knit Along) and share tips and progress with fellow creators
  • Create your own Ravelry page; record and share your projects
